Invalid Dawn Poem Rhyme Scheme and Analysis
Rhyme Scheme: ABCB DEDEFCFC GDGD| Above the grey down | A |
| Gather wan the glows | B |
| Relieved by leaden | C |
| Gleams a star gang goes | B |
| - | |
| In the dark valley | D |
| Here and there enters | E |
| A spark laggardly | D |
| For the faint watchers | E |
| That were there all night | F |
| Factory station | C |
| And hospital light | F |
| Tired of lamp star sun | C |
| - | |
| Bound to my strait bed | G |
| Uncurtained I see | D |
| Heaven itself law led | G |
| Earth in slavery | D |
Elizabeth Daryush
